Chile - Hospital Discharges for Paralytic Ileus and Intestinal Obstruction Without Hernia

Since 2014, Chile Hospital Discharges for Paralytic Ileus and Intestinal Obstruction Without Hernia jumped by 1.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 19 among other countries in Hospital Discharges for Paralytic Ileus and Intestinal Obstruction Without Hernia with 6,420 Hospital Discharges. Chile is overtaken by Czech Republic, which was ranked number 18 at 6,714 Hospital Discharges and is followed by Israel at 5,918 Hospital Discharges. Germany, France and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Turkey recorded the best 5 years average growth at +5.7% per year, while Slovakia was the worst growing country at -1.9% per year.
